Sunday, July 12, 2009

As Space Station Nears Completion, It Faces End of Mission - washingtonpost.com

As Space Station Nears Completion, It Faces End of Mission - washingtonpost.com: "Space Station Is Near Completion, Maybe the End
Plan to 'De-Orbit' in 2016"

span.fullpost {display:inline;}

No comments: